Bring a large pot of salted water to a boil. Add the high-protein spaghetti and cook according to the package instructions for al dente texture. Reserve 1/2 cup of pasta water, then drain the pasta and set aside.
Heat 2 tablespoons of olive oil in a large skillet over medium heat. Add the chopped onion and sautΓ© for 3-4 minutes until softened. Add the minced garlic and cook for an additional 1 minute until fragrant.
Add the lean ground turkey (or chicken) to the skillet. Cook, breaking it apart with a wooden spoon, until browned and fully cooked, about 5-6 minutes.
Stir in the tomato paste, crushed tomatoes, dried oregano, dried basil, salt, and black pepper. Mix well and let the sauce simmer over low heat for 10 minutes to allow the flavors to meld together.
Stir the ricotta cheese into the sauce and cook for another 2-3 minutes until creamy. If the sauce is too thick, add a splash of the reserved pasta water to reach your desired consistency.
Toss the cooked spaghetti with the sauce in the skillet until evenly coated. Sprinkle grated Parmesan cheese over the top and mix lightly.
Serve the spaghetti immediately, garnished with fresh parsley if desired. Enjoy your high-protein meal!
